Perigon Wealth Management's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, Perigon Wealth Management held 1,079 positions worth $861M, up 20% from $715M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Perigon Wealth Management deployed $54.9M of net new capital in Q4 2020, opening 693 new positions and adding to 231 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ares 1-5 Year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F: 19,314 shares worth $1.07M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 19%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Blackstone, an estimated $1.32M trimmed.
